  • created sense approved 蔡琰 · cài​yǎn · Cai Yan — "Initial import from upstream dictionary"

    蔡琰

    cài​yǎn

    Cai Yan

    An influential female poet and musician (172–?) of the late Eastern Han dynasty, also known by her courtesy name [[蔡文姬|蔡文姬|cai4 wen2 ji1]]; she was the daughter of the scholar [[蔡邕|蔡邕|cai4 yong1]] and was famously ransomed from captivity among the Xiongnu by [[曹操|曹操|cao2 cao1]].
